I had this airsoft SVD I got for my son last year and go to wondering if I could massage a Savage .22 into it......well after some work and a long weekend in the basement I came up with this.
I was able to figure out how to get the stripped Savage action to mount securely with only on tapped mounting spot on the receiver that wont affect the appearance if removed. The SVD took most of the work. Little filing here and there. The fake mag cover was maybe the trickiest part, cut and grind until it worked. It slips right over the factory 10 rd. It is purely for looks. I have not fired it though. The barrel was originally 16.5" so I extended it with a threaded portion that is much wider then .22LR. I plan of locating a 20" barrel and replace it. The joint is right under the gas piston were it attaches to the barrel. Other than that it functions dry charging and the safety still function. The SVD safety goes up and down but is just for looks.
I weathered it with some steel wool afterwards. Future upgrades are some real wood furniture, AIRSOFT stuff of course......thats if this works well.
